Transaction 53ac4d66b8101ac94ac1b24dd178b9e54466bd0c8eea95f2424469c8985a5de3

1 Input
2 Outputs
  • 53ac4d66b8101ac94ac1b24dd178b9e54466bd0c8eea95f2424469c8985a5de3:0
  • value  26236
    address  1LFX6GDGmzNZcBkteVmCXdh6WyNFmKcrZY
  • 53ac4d66b8101ac94ac1b24dd178b9e54466bd0c8eea95f2424469c8985a5de3:1
  • value  4373939
    address  37ftgMZEABLxLXaCvN81acwwQvE5ncDNzQ